McConnell dodges question on Trump verdict

(Washington, DC)  --  Senate Republican Leader Mitch McConnell says it will be up to the American people to decide if Donald Trump is fit to be president in 2024.  

His comments come after a New York jury found Trump sexually abused and defamed writer E. Jean Carroll decades ago in a civil case brought against the former president.  

McConnell declined to say whether he accepted the verdict as legitimate.  

He said he had no observations about the case, but added Republicans will have to settle it in the primaries next year.
